Sep 25, 2012· Cement is made by strongly heating a mixture of limestone, silica and clay in a kiln until small peasized lumps called 'clinker' form. This is then ground to a powder, the key ingredients of which are dicalcium silicate, tricalcium silicate, tricalcium aluminate and .
